Basketball Recap: Twiggs County Cobras vs. Johnson County Trojans
Twiggs County lost against Johnson County last Tuesday, and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Friday. The Twiggs County Cobras fell to the Johnson County Trojans 67-61. The Cobras have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.

Despite the loss, Twiggs County still got an impressive performance from Daniel Pitts, who posted 29 points. The game was Pitts' fourth in a row with at least 16 points. Demontrez Brown was another key player, putting up nine points.
Twiggs County's defeat dropped their record down to 7-19. As for Johnson County, they are on a roll lately: they've won three of their last four matchups, which provided a nice bump to their 9-12 record this season.
The two teams are set to take part in some playoff action in their next matches. Twiggs County will take on Randolph-Clay at 6:00 p.m. on Wednesday. Randolph-Clay will roll in looking for their 14th straight victory, something Twiggs County surely won't give up without a fight. As for Johnson County, they will square off against Jenkins at 6:00 p.m. on Wednesday. Jenkins will roll in looking for their fourth straight win, something Johnson County surely won't give up without a fight.
